Fish Fried in Bread Crumbs

Pollock is a rather nutritious fish, it can be served even without a side dish. But with a side dish, it will be more satisfying. Cook pollock in bread crumbs using this recipe and serve with pasta for a delicious dinner guaranteed!

Ingredients

  • Pollock – 1 pc.
  • Pasta – 250 g
  • Salt – 2¾ teaspoon
  • Bread crumbs – 2 tbsp
  • Vegetable oil – 2 tbsp
  • Butter – 50 g
  • Ground black pepper – ⅔ teaspoon.

Directions

  1. Peel the fish, wash and cut into pieces.
  2. Dip each piece of fish in bread crumbs.
  3. Heat oil over medium heat. Put the pieces of fish in the heated oil.
  4. Fry the fish for 2-4 minutes on each side. Season with salt (3/4 teaspoon) and pepper.
  5. Pour in 60 ml of water. Now simmer the fish over medium heat for 15 minutes.
  6. While the fish is stewing, you can cook a side dish (I have pasta, but you can also boil any cereals or potatoes). Pour 1.5 liters of water into a saucepan, add 2 teaspoons of salt. Bring water to a boil.
  7. Pour pasta into boiling salted water and cook over moderate heat for 5-7 minutes. Then drain the water. Rinse pasta under warm water, add butter, and stir.
  8. Put fish and garnish on a plate and serve.
